Alfred (Antony Francis) Gell (12 June 1945 – 28 January 1997) was a British social anthropologist whose most influential work concerned art, language, symbolism and ritual.

Works

  • Metamorphosis of the Cassowaries: Umeda Society, Language and Ritual, London: Athlone, 1975.
  • Wrapping in Images: Tattooing in Polynesia, Oxford: Clarendon, 1993.
